Fry them. If they're not wet already from the packaging, dip them in water then shake excess water off and roll in seasoned frying starch (potato or corn is best but any will do). Wait for the starch to hydrate and roll it a second time then into the fryer it goes. When golden, take out, wick on paper and consume your crunchy deliciousness.
